Correct, bur with the right set of idler pulleys you can eliminate almost all the belt slip associated with high RPM/high boost applications. The cog drives do have a certain "wow" factor to them and they sound cool to boot, but they are not really meant for daily street use. I say leave the cog drives to the drag only crowd...
